Industry Overview:

The global polymer bearings market was valued at USD 2.14 billion in 2025 and is estimated to reach USD 2.30 billion in 2026, reflecting a growth rate of 7.5%. The polymer bearings market is driven by increasing demand for lightweight, corrosion-resistant, and self-lubricating components that reduce maintenance and improve energy efficiency in diverse industries such as automotive, industrial machinery, and medical equipment. Adoption of polymer bearings in electric vehicles and automation systems is accelerating due to their ability to enhance performance while lowering wear and noise levels. Rapid industrialisation and expanding manufacturing sectors in the Asia-Pacific are pushing for durable, cost-effective bearing solutions. Sustainability goals and the shift from metal to high-performance polymer alternatives are further supporting market growth.

Factors Shaping the Next Decade

Market Gaps / Restraints: High competition from traditional metal bearings remains a restraint, as polymers sometimes have limitations under very high loads and extreme temperatures. Material compatibility challenges in certain chemical environments restrict broader adoption.

Key Trends and Innovations: The market is witnessing growth in self-lubricating, PTFE-free polymer materials and reinforced composite bearings for improved wear and temperature performance. Digitalization trends, including sensor-enabled and condition-monitoring bearings, are gaining traction. Companies are also developing eco-friendly polymer lines using recycled materials.

Potential Opportunities: Expanding electric vehicle production offers significant opportunities for lightweight, low-maintenance bearing solutions. Growth in automation, robotics, and aerospace sectors is driving specialized bearing designs. Rising demand for corrosion-resistant and FDA-compliant bearings in medical and food processing industries further fuels market expansion.


Recent Industry Updates: 

• June 2026: igus GmbH expanded its high-load polymer bearing portfolio for robotics and automation applications.

• April 2026: SKF introduced advanced composite polymer bearing solutions for energy-efficient industrial systems.

• November 2025: Saint-Gobain Performance Plastics launched next-generation self-lubricating bearing materials for high-temperature environments.

• March 2025: Igus has introduced a new potent plastic substance called Xirodur MT180 for its deep-grooved Xiros ball bearings, which are only used in medical technology.

Regulatory Environment and Policy Support

Government Regulations & Supportive Policies: The industry is guided by International Organization for Standardization (ISO) tribology standards, American Society for Testing and Materials (ASTM) material performance standards, and European Union REACH chemical compliance regulations, ensuring safety, durability, and environmental compatibility of polymer materials.

Key Government Initiatives: Industrial automation programs, electric mobility initiatives, renewable energy expansion policies, and manufacturing modernization schemes across major economies are supporting increased adoption of advanced polymer bearing solutions.
